Andrew Swiston is a scholar working on General Economics, Econometrics and Finance, Economics and Econometrics and Finance. According to data from OpenAlex, Andrew Swiston has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 402 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 29 papers in General Economics, Econometrics and Finance, 25 papers in Economics and Econometrics and 21 papers in Finance. Recurrent topics in Andrew Swiston’s work include Monetary Policy and Economic Impact (24 papers), Global Financial Crisis and Policies (19 papers) and Economic Theory and Policy (14 papers). Andrew Swiston is often cited by papers focused on Monetary Policy and Economic Impact (24 papers), Global Financial Crisis and Policies (19 papers) and Economic Theory and Policy (14 papers). Andrew Swiston coll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and New Zealand. Andrew Swiston's co-authors include Tamim Bayoumi, Alexander Herman, Francesco Grigoli, Aleš Bulı́ř, Gabriel Di Bella, Yan Sun, Benedict Clements, Kalpana Kochhar, Nujin Suphaphiphat and Catherine Pattillo and has published in prestigious journals such as Energy Economics, IMF Staff Papers and RePEc: Research Papers in Economics.
